파이썬에서는 sys 모듈을 사용하여 프로그램에 인수를 전달할 수 있다.
sys 모듈을 사용하기 위해선 import sys 를 추가해주면 된다.
import sys
args = sys.argv[1:]
for i in args:
print(i)
위 test.py는 단순하게 argv에 전달된 인수 중 argv[1]부터 하나씩 출력하는 코드이다.
test.py X Y Z
명령을 내리면 다음과 같이 출력된다.
X
Y
Z
인수를 전달하고 다양한 함수를 응용하여 프로그램을 만들 수 있다.
'Python' 카테고리의 다른 글
[Python] 문제 풀기 21~40 Python문자열 1 (0) | 2023.07.09 |
---|---|
[Python] 문제 풀기 1~20 Python변수 (0) | 2023.07.06 |
Boto3 개요 및 사용 예시 (0) | 2023.04.27 |
Python 문자열의 기본 함수 (0) | 2023.04.17 |
Python 기본 용어 & print() & 문자열 (0) | 2023.04.17 |